What does NH stand for?
NH stands for "North-Holland"
How to abbreviate "North-Holland"?
"North-Holland" can be abbreviated as NH
What is the meaning of NH abbreviation?
The meaning of NH abbreviation is "North-Holland"
What does NH mean?
NH as abbreviation means "North-Holland"